Volleyball ranked 25th in latest AVCA Division III Top 25 Poll

The Muskingum volleyball team was ranked 25th in the latest American Volleyball Coaches Association Top 25 Poll that was released on Tuesday. The AVCA Division III Top 25 Poll is selected by Division III head coaches representing the eight NCAA regions.

The Muskies are off to a 3-2 start this season with wins against Ohio Wesleyan, Wittenberg and Hanover.

As a team, Muskingum has tallied 246 kills, 217 assists, 337 digs, and 24 blocks. The Muskies averaging 11.71 kills per set, 10.33 assists per set, 16.05 digs per set, and 1.14 blocks per set, while also registering a .189 hiting percentage.

Senior Maddie McGee leads the squad with a team-high 63 kills, averaging 3.50 kills per set and also has recorded 39 digs.

Senior Brooke Bigrigg has logged in a team-high of 72 digs, averaging 3.73 digs per set, and is second on team in kills with 50.

Sophomore Raegan Flood is third on the team in kills with 34, averaging 1.62 kills per set. Sophomore Emma Conrad has notched 54 digs, averaging 2.57 digs per set, while senior Erin Dickson has logged 94 assists, averaging 4.48 assists per set.

The Muskies next compete at the Gio Memorial Tournament hosted by Johns Hopkins, on Friday, September 10, against Virginia Wesleyan. Game time is slated for 5:00 p.m.
